"We had a four night stay in Norrkƶping for a music festival and the Hotel President was nicely located between the station and the festival venue.
On arrival the staff were friendly and welcoming and all the members of staff we encountered during our stay were friendly and helpful.
Our room was lovely with plenty of space, a separate sitting area with a sofa, wardrobe, large flat screen tv, extra towels and pillows in the wardrobe, a desk and chair and a good size, comfortable bed. The windows were large, making the room light and airy.
Breakfast featured a good selection of hot and cold food and drink and, although my partner and I have very different views on what constitutes a good breakfast, we both ate extremely well."

The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 60°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 32°F. The snowiest months in Jonaker are December, January, November, and February, with each month seeing an average of 20 inches of snowfall.
